Daniela Cervelle Zancanela et al.
Photomedicine and laser surgery, 29(10), 699-705 (2011-06-15)
A promising new treatment in dentistry involves the photodynamic process, which utilizes a combination of two therapeutic agents, namely a photosensitizer drug and a low dose of visible light. We investigated the in vitro effect of low intensity laser irradiation
E C C Tapajós et al.
Oral oncology, 44(11), 1073-1079 (2008-07-16)
In this study, oral carcinoma cells were used to evaluate chloroaluminum-phthalocyanine encapsulated in liposomes as the photosensitizer agent in support of photodynamic therapy (PDT). João Paulo Figueiró Longo et al.
Journal of photochemistry and photobiology. B, Biology, 94(2), 143-146 (2008-12-23)
In this paper we describe the efficacy of the liposomal-AlClPc (aluminum-chloro-phthalocyanine) formulation in PDT study against Ehrlich tumor cells proliferation in immunocompetent swiss mice tongue. Experiments were conduced in sixteen tumor induced mice that were divided in three control groups:
